Telecom Egypt Pushes Back Against Rumors of Data Center Monetization

Apr 03, 2026 | Posted by Dave Young

 Telecom Egypt has formally denied reports that it intends to convert its regional data center complex into a ‘cash-generating asset.’ The speculation originated from a March 30 report by the Egyptian newspaper Al-Mal, which suggested the move was intended to fund the company’s local expansion and business growth.

It remains uncertain if the reports pointed toward a property sale or a shift in colocation strategy. Regardless, Telecom Egypt released a statement through the Egyptian Exchange on March 30, confirming that no new developments have occurred and promising full transparency regarding any future updates. The state operator’s footprint currently includes 11 data centers across Egypt, anchored by its primary 4.6MW, four-campus facility in West Cairo’s Smart Village, which serves as a major hub for global submarine cable connectivity.

Despite its recent denial regarding broader monetization plans, Telecom Egypt remains on track to divest a majority stake in its Cairo Regional Data Hub (RDH) to Helios, as announced last year. Egypt continues to position itself as a strategic bridge for global telecommunications networks. To capitalize on this, government officials—including the Ministers of Electricity and Communications—are developing a framework of energy incentives and licensing reforms designed to scale up data center investment in the region, as reported by Fintech Gate.

To cement its status as a leading regional data center hub, Egypt has formed a specialized working group to spearhead a national strategy for green data infrastructure. According to government officials, the country’s competitive advantage lies in its unique geographic position and robust fiber-optic connectivity. This initiative supports the broader 'Digital Egypt' and 'Vision 2030' goals. With 15 active submarine cable systems—and three more currently in development—Egypt is leveraging its low-latency links to Europe and Asia to attract global investors.
